The first step is understanding what assisted living truly offers. It is designed for seniors who value their independence but may need help with daily activities like bathing, dressing, medication management, or meal preparation. Beyond this hands-on care, a good facility provides a social framework to combat isolation, with organized activities, communal dining, and opportunities for connection. As you explore options in the surrounding areas of Bryan County or nearby Durant, consider what environment would best suit your family member’s personality and needs. Schedule in-person visits, and try to go at different times of the day. Observe not just the cleanliness and safety features, but the atmosphere. Do staff members address residents by name? Is there a sense of calm and warmth? For a senior from Mead, a facility with outdoor spaces to enjoy Oklahoma’s changing seasons or activities that reflect local interests can make a significant difference in how quickly they feel at home.
Practical considerations are paramount. Inquire about the specifics of the care plan, how it is adjusted over time, and the staff-to-resident ratio. Understand all costs involved and what is included in the base fee versus additional charges. Given Oklahoma’s climate, with its hot summers and potential for severe weather, it’s wise to ask about emergency preparedness plans, cooling systems, and how the facility ensures comfort and safety year-round. Transportation services are also a key question, as they can enable residents to attend medical appointments in Durant or even participate in community events back in Mead.
